• Labs
  • Projects
  • People
  • Output
  • Explore
  • Engage
  • About
  • Contacts
Output
Output

staging robots

By Mesh Lab

2025

“Staging Robots” was delivered as a keynote at the Symposium on Future Theatre, Shanghai, China (6 December 2025).

Team

  • Louis-Philippe Demers

© 2026 VCUarts Qatar. All rights reserved.

  • Facebook
  • Instagram
  • LinkedIn
  • Privacy Policy
  • Labs
  • Projects
  • People
  • Output
  • Explore
  • Engage
  • About
  • Contacts
  • Privacy Policy
Made by V–A Studio